Cyrano Video transformed its debugging and customer support workflows with PlayerZero, reducing engineering hours for support and bug fixes by 80% while enabling Customer Success to resolve 40% of issues without developer escalation. By combining session data, automated triage, and AI-powered root cause analysis, PlayerZero improved release quality, accelerated incident resolution, and strengthened collaboration across engineering and support teams.
